After being coddled by the effortless power and overtaking ability of a 2-ton turbo diesel SUV for the past 7 years, it is a genuine joy to be back in the helm of a light and agile car. The way it can make a wallowy, humdrum 15-minute commute to a showcase of what a momentum car can do. It doesn’t hurt either that it is less expensive to buy parts and modifications for the car, not that it really needs any but scratching the modding itch inflicts a much smaller dent in my overall financial position than when I was focused on fiddling with the SUV.

show-off One-Year Old Mazda CX60 Appreciation Post

Thumbnail
gallery
302 Upvotes

This car has been with me and my family for over a year and I still look back at her everytime I park! Looks great in other colors too but this blue imo is very underrated.
“Impractical” for some because of the Inline 6 but I’ve been getting around 8km/l in city driving which is not bad imo.
Gets the job done, has plenty of power, and feels very planted even on sharp turns. Very happy we got this car, no regrets!
